What is Gibraltar Pound (GIP)

The Gibraltar Pound (GIP) is the official currency of Gibraltar, a British Overseas Territory located at the southern tip of Spain. It was introduced in 1927 and is pegged to the British Pound Sterling (GBP) at par, meaning that 1 GIP is equal to 1 GBP. The currency is subdivided into 100 pence, and its symbol is £.

GIP coins come in various denominations ranging from 1 penny to £2, while banknotes are available in £5, £10, £20, £50, and £100 denominations. The design of Gibraltar Pounds often features local historical figures and symbols, reflecting the territory's rich cultural heritage and connection to the United Kingdom.

One important aspect of the Gibraltar Pound is that it can only be used within Gibraltar. However, British Pound notes and coins are also accepted in Gibraltar, and you will find that both are interchangeable in daily transactions.

What is Solomon Islands Dollar (SBD)

The Solomon Islands Dollar (SBD) is the official currency of the Solomon Islands, a group of islands located in the southwestern Pacific Ocean. It was introduced in 1977, replacing the Solomon Islands Pound (SIP). The currency is subdivided into 100 cents, and its symbol is $ or SBD to distinguish it from other dollar-based currencies.

SBD is issued in various denominations of coins and banknotes. Coins are available in denominations of 10, 20, and 50 cents, and $1, while banknotes are issued in $2, $5, $10, $20, $50 and $100 denominations. The design on the currency often highlights the intricate cultural traditions and natural beauty of the Solomon Islands, showcasing local flora and fauna.

The Solomon Islands Dollar is used exclusively in the country, but it can sometimes be exchanged abroad. As with GIP, exchange rates for SBD can vary based on market conditions.
